diff options
author | Ross Kettleson <kettro@google.com> | 2020-06-18 00:17:28 -0700 |
---|---|---|
committer | Ross Kettleson <kettro@google.com> | 2020-06-18 00:17:28 -0700 |
commit | 07c55ee687b92319c5fba114b844fe5564211c5f (patch) | |
tree | 80641c5a501175c0baa9522a74f46aa3fd43d64f | |
parent | 22f90c4bc11a9d8f1800b119c82c6801a7eb58a0 (diff) | |
download | generic-07c55ee687b92319c5fba114b844fe5564211c5f.tar.gz |
CAVP: CMAC protos
Background:
CMAC needs protos
New Stuff:
* Request, result protos
Bug: 156130131
Test: Manual
Signed-off-by: Ross Kettleson <kettro@google.com>
Change-Id: I930bc03cc9628ddbd9502167e8f6f28fbef9c90c
-rw-r--r-- | nugget/proto/nugget/app/protoapi/testing_api.proto | 14 |
1 files changed, 14 insertions, 0 deletions
diff --git a/nugget/proto/nugget/app/protoapi/testing_api.proto b/nugget/proto/nugget/app/protoapi/testing_api.proto index 12ab065..c1c271f 100644 --- a/nugget/proto/nugget/app/protoapi/testing_api.proto +++ b/nugget/proto/nugget/app/protoapi/testing_api.proto @@ -322,6 +322,20 @@ message CavpEcdsaSigVerTestResult { bool result = 2; } +message CavpCmacGenTest { + uint32 offset = 1; + uint32 key_size = 2; + uint32 mac_len = 3; + uint32 total_len = 4; + bytes key = 5; + bytes msg = 6; +} + +message CavpCmacGenTestResult { + DcryptError result_code = 1; + bytes mac = 2; +} + message TrngTest { uint32 number_of_bytes = 1; } |